mantratronic wrote:this is a lot of fun. :D gonna have to rename a lot of patterns though as 90% of my files are just full of "00 1.break" rather then "c7 break" :oops:
yeah, imho the idea to use pattern's names to decide which play together is not a good one. It doesn't make sense since live is supposed to be a quick arrangement view and you don't want to go into every pattern and change its name. Also its not possible to have the same pattern in multiple slots right now. You want to freely drag the patterns around in the grid and also have copy / paste so you can use THE SAME pattern number twice or many times in different rows, just look at how ableton live does it. The coupling to pattern names should be removed entirely. You have to be able to manualy choose which machine-pattern plays in each slot / row of the grid.

No it still doesn't make sense since it doesn't allow you to reuse a given pattern multiple times. It goes against both ableton and buzz's philosophie (we could go back to the oldschool pattern-order-list, would be just as bad...). You cannot quickly arrange a bunch of patterns in jeskola live right now and trigger different rows containing (some of the same) patterns, which is missing the whole point of the machine imho. It's a fixed, static grid right now, not very suitable for live (and especially) jamming purposes.
Sorry... but looking at ableton live for just 15 minutes makes you realize why this is not how you want it to be. Or look at buzz's normal sequencer: it would be insane if the name mattered there and you could only use every pattern ONE time in the sequence. The name should be just that, a name, and nothing else.
